Regular executive health checks function as a structured pulse survey for leadership teams, blending qualitative discussions with quantitative indicators to gauge how well directors and senior managers collaborate. The aim is not blame or praise but clarity: identifying bottlenecks in communication, misalignments in priorities, and the cadence of decision-making. Leaders should design a recurring process that invites candid feedback, maps influence without fear, and anchors conversations in observable behaviors. By normalizing psychological safety, teams learn to surface dissent early, test hypotheses, and adjust course before small missteps become strategic derailments. A well-structured checkup becomes an ongoing mechanism for improvement rather than an episodic event.
The regular check should start with a concise framework that defines what success looks like across three domains: team dynamics, decision quality, and strategic alignment. In team dynamics, assess trust, psychological safety, and the clarity of roles. For decision quality, examine the speed, adequacy of information, consideration of risk, and alignment with values. Strategic alignment centers on how well initiatives map to the organization’s mission, market realities, and resource constraints. Capture concrete observations, not impressions, and pair them with specific examples. The process benefits from a rotating facilitator to reduce bias, plus a neutral note-taker to preserve a factual record for future reference and accountability.

An effective check starts with a transparent invitation that explains the purpose, scope, and cadence of the sessions. Participants should come prepared with recent decisions, outcomes, and the context behind key moves. The facilitator guides a structured dialogue that covers recent wins, ongoing challenges, and the health of internal communication channels. It is essential to separate outcomes from personalities, focusing on observable behavior and measurable results rather than reputations. A well-documented recap highlights what changed, what remains uncertain, and which decisions require revisiting. The rigor of documentation helps maintain continuity across leadership transitions and strengthens accountability for follow-through.

To ensure compact, productive discussions, leaders should adopt a consistent set of evaluation prompts. Questions might include: Were the data complete and timely? Did we consider diverse viewpoints and risk scenarios? Were trade-offs clearly articulated and aligned with strategic priorities? How did the team test assumptions before committing resources? Was accountability assigned with measurable milestones? By rotating focus across sessions—one meeting emphasizes data integrity, the next emphasizes culture, and another concentrates on strategic fit—the checks become comprehensive without becoming repetitive. Over time, this rhythm builds a shared language that reduces ambiguity during critical moments.

In practice, you can begin each health check with a brief baseline metric review, followed by narrative updates from each executive. Quantitative indicators could include decision cycle time, risk-adjusted ROI, and initiative completion rates. Qualitative signals might address cohesion during strategic planning, willingness to challenge assumptions, and responsiveness to external feedback. The blend of numbers and narratives yields a fuller picture than either alone. The key is to track progress against a small number of strategically chosen metrics and to adjust them as the business environment shifts. Consistent measurement creates a reliable benchmark for leadership performance across cycles.

Beyond metrics, the health check should explore the quality of decisions through a structured lens. Evaluate the quality of information inputs, the diversity of perspectives considered, and the degree of explicitness around uncertainties. Ask whether the decision premise remained stable as new data emerged and if the final choice reflected both risk tolerance and strategic intent. It is equally important to assess the post-decision learning loop: were outcomes reviewed, and did the team adapt promptly when results diverged from expectations? A disciplined approach to learning transforms occasional missteps into long-term competitive advantages.

The third area, strategic alignment, centers on how leadership choices reinforce the organization’s overarching goals. Check whether a portfolio of initiatives is coherent, mutually reinforcing, and properly sequenced. Leaders should verify that resource allocation reflects stated priorities and that milestones are calibrated to enable timely course corrections. Alignment also involves communicating a clear, consistent narrative to stakeholders outside the executive circle. When strategy is well aligned, teams grasp not only what to do but why it matters, which accelerates execution and strengthens trust. Regularly revisiting alignment helps prevent drift and reinforces organizational resilience.
A practical method for ensuring alignment is to translate strategic intent into actionable roadmaps with explicit touchpoints. These roadmaps should include short-term tasks, medium-term milestones, and long-term horizon goals, each linked to responsible owners and measurable outcomes. The health check should verify that cross-functional dependencies are identified and managed, not assumed. In addition, leadership should assess the integrity of the decision-making authority embedded in the governance structure, ensuring that escalation paths and approval thresholds support rapid yet prudent action. Clear governance reduces ambiguity during times of change and fosters confidence.

The governance dimension of executive health checks is often overlooked, yet it underpins sustainable performance. Review how information flows across the leadership layer, including the cadence and quality of briefing decks, dashboards, and risk registers. Effective governance requires that data be timely, reliable, and interpretable by diverse audiences. The check should also examine the alignment between governance rituals and actual behavior—do meetings produce decisions and commitments, or merely reports? When governance drives disciplined action, teams demonstrate greater adaptability, maintain strategic focus, and prevent siloed escalation. The objective is to create a trusted structure that supports clarity, accountability, and momentum.
Additionally, the health check should assess the durability of relationships among the executive team. Interpersonal trust, conflict management, and shared ownership of outcomes influence execution more than any formal process alone. Leaders benefit from deliberate practice in listening, reframing, and constructive disagreement. The facilitator can introduce scenarios that reveal unspoken concerns and test the team’s capacity to navigate controversy without fracturing collaboration. Cultivating these relational muscles strengthens resilience in the face of adversity and reinforces a culture where diverse viewpoints are valued.
The final component of regular executive health checks is the action-oriented follow-up. After each session, compile a concise improvement plan that assigns owners, timelines, and success criteria. Prioritize interventions that address the most persistent gaps identified during the discussion, whether they relate to data quality, decision speed, or role clarity. Schedule a short-loop review to verify progress and adjust strategies as needed. Communication plays a central role here: succinct, transparent updates to the broader organization help sustain trust and demonstrate accountability. When teams see visible progress, engagement rises, and momentum compounds across initiatives.
Over time, a durable health-check routine shifts from a periodic exercise to an ingrained leadership discipline. The practices—structured dialogue, evidence-based assessment, disciplined governance, and proactive learning—become part of the organization’s growth engine. Leaders who adopt this approach consistently will detect subtle drift before it becomes a problem, align decisions with strategic intent, and nurture a culture of continuous improvement. The result is not a single successful project but a sustainable pattern of higher-quality decisions, stronger team dynamics, and enduring strategic coherence across the enterprise.
